DAVID BAZAN

Strange Negotiations

2011-05-11

Former Pedro the Lion front man with a slight Christian/spiritual bend, David Bazan relies heavily on melody to move his guitar heavy indie rock. What makes this record especially different is that it is the first Bazan has recorded with a full band.

At times loud and driving and at other times sparse and moving David Bazan has really come into his own as a songwriter focusing on themes of loss, accountability with oneself and learning about and acknowledging your own limitations.

Reviewed by Devon Cunningham
